
Cooking Other Foods in Your Hot Pot
WARNING: DO NOT USE THE HOT POT TO HEAT OIL, OR TO MELT BUTTER.
CAUTION: The Hot Pot is not suitable for heating solid foods unless liquids are added.
Add liquids (e.g. water, milk, soup, etc.), or a mixture of liquids and solids (e.g. chili, stew, etc.).
WARNING: Do not place any container inside the Hot Pot — all foods must be removed from the container, can, etc. before being put into the Hot Pot.
WARNING: Do not overfill the Hot Pot. If the Hot Pot is overfilled, there is a risk that boiling liquids may boil over.
1.Remove the Lid. (See Operating Instructions.)
2.Fill the Hot Pot with 8 to 32 ounces, (1 to 4 cups) of liquids or a mixture of liquids and solid food.
3.Press the On/Off Switch to On.
